Iran’s IKCO plans to manufacture three new cars

5 May 2015 - 10:38


TEHRAN (ISNA)- Iranian largest state-run car maker (IKCO) plans to present three new cars, said the IKCO CEO, Hashem Yekkeh-Zareh.

Each of the three products would be presented in six months period, he said, adding the first two ones would be respectively unveiled this year and next year.

He said that the third one is being designed.

Yekkeh-Zareh then said that the company’s output is set for 3.000.000 cars for 2025.

Iran Khodro Industrial Group, also known as IKCO, is the leading Iranian vehicle manufacturer, with headquarters in Tehran. IKCO was founded in 1962 and it produced 688,000 passenger cars in 2009. IKCO manufactures vehicles, including Samand, Peugeot and Renault cars, and trucks, minibuses and buses.
